Abstract
A method was developed for the simultaneous determination of four kinds of estrogens (hexoestrol, diethylstilbestrol, estrone, and 17-beta-estradiol) in feed by gas chromatography-mass spectrometry (GC-MS). After the sample was extracted by ethyl ether and cleaned-up on HLB phase extraction column, four kinds of estrogens were derived and quantified in gas chromatography-mass spectrometry. The results showed that the linear detectable ranged from 2.5 ng · mL−1 to 250 ng · mL−1 for hexoestrol and from 5 ng · mL−1 to 500 ng · mL−1 for three other estrogens with the correlation coefficients (R2) were no less than 0.990. The recoveries were in the range of 76.34%–96.33% and the relative standard deviation was no more than 22.7%. The limits of quantitation (LOQ) for all analytics were between 10 ug · kg−1 and 20 ug · kg−1. The method was accurate and sensitive and could meet the actual requirements for the analyses of feed samples.
